Implement `strip_prefix` for `BStr` by deferring to `slice::strip_prefix`
on the underlying `&[u8]`.

It is also possible to get this method by implementing
`core::slice::SlicePattern` for `BStr`. `SlicePattern` is unstable, so this
seems more reasonable.

+
+    /// Strip a prefix from `self`. Delegates to [`slice::strip_prefix`].
+    ///
+    /// # Example
+    /// ```
+    /// use kernel::b_str;
+    /// assert_eq!(Some(b_str!("bar")), 
b_str!("foobar").strip_prefix(b_str!("foo")));
+    /// assert_eq!(None, b_str!("foobar").strip_prefix(b_str!("bar")));
+    /// assert_eq!(Some(b_str!("foobar")), 
b_str!("foobar").strip_prefix(b_str!("")));
+    /// assert_eq!(Some(b_str!("")), 
b_str!("foobar").strip_prefix(b_str!("foobar")));
+    /// ```
+    pub fn strip_prefix(&self, pattern: impl AsRef<Self>) -> Option<&BStr> {
+        self.deref()
+            .strip_prefix(pattern.as_ref().deref())
+            .map(Self::from_bytes)
+    }
